Raised Barrel Hinges on Offset Frames: Why the Frame Reveal Drives the Hinge Decision

When the Frame Reveal Becomes the Hardware Problem

This article explains what raised barrel hinges are, when deep or offset frame conditions require them, and what specifiers and installers need to confirm before ordering. It applies to commercial subs working with hollow metal frames, architects detailing door openings with projecting trim, and facility teams managing replacements on frames that have never accepted a standard hinge cleanly.

What Is a Raised Barrel Hinge?

A raised barrel hinge is a full mortise hinge whose barrel (the knuckle assembly joining the two leaves) sits proud of the face of the door and frame rather than flush with them. The raised position creates additional clearance between the door face and the frame or adjacent wall when the door swings open. It is not a wide-throw hinge — the leaves themselves remain standard width. The geometry change happens at the barrel, not the leaf span.

Raised barrel hinges are available for both square-edge doors and beveled-edge doors. On the jamb surface mount application, the door is sometimes described as double mortised. Because the barrel projects, all three mounting configurations — square edge, beveled edge, and jamb surface — may restrict the maximum degree of opening depending on how deep the frame reveal actually is. That restriction must be evaluated on every opening before the hinge is specified.

The Frame Conditions That Create the Problem

Standard full mortise hinges assume a relatively shallow frame stop and a door edge that sits close to the frame face. When those assumptions break down, the door can bind, fail to open fully, or contact the frame before reaching the intended stop position. Common conditions that push specifiers toward a raised barrel solution include:

  • Deep frame reveals where the door sits well back from the wall face, leaving the hinge knuckle buried in the reveal
  • Double egress frames, which use an alternate head profile where latch edges of opposing doors meet — standard barrel hinges will not fit the head geometry of a double egress pair
  • Projecting trim or applied casing that the swinging door would strike before reaching 90 degrees
  • Offset pivots or slip bucks where the plane of the door face does not align with the standard hinge barrel position
  • Renovation openings where original frame depth was built for a thicker wall assembly and replacement doors sit at a different face plane than the original hardware anticipated

Raised Barrel vs. Wide-Throw: Choosing the Right Fix

Installers sometimes reach for a wide-throw hinge when a raised barrel would be the better call, and vice versa. Understanding the difference prevents a second trip to the jobsite.

  • Wide-throw hinges add width to one or both leaves, moving the door face farther from the frame face. Use them when you need to clear projecting trim or a wall that extends beyond the frame face on the pull side.
  • Raised barrel hinges keep leaf width standard but lift the pivot point. Use them when the reveal depth is the constraint — particularly when the door needs to clear the frame stop or head profile during the swing, not just at full open.
  • In some deep-reveal conditions, neither solution alone is sufficient, and the specifier should evaluate whether a pivot system or a different frame profile is the correct answer.

Specifying Raised Barrel Hinges: What Has to Be Confirmed

Getting this hinge right requires more field information than a standard full mortise spec. Before ordering, confirm the following:

  • Square edge or beveled edge — raised barrel hinges are cataloged separately for each. Mixing them causes alignment problems at the barrel joint.
  • Frame reveal depth — even with a raised barrel, a very deep reveal may still restrict swing. Document the actual reveal and compare it against the manufacturer’s maximum opening degree for that barrel height.
  • Door weight and fire rating — raised barrel versions are available in standard weight and heavy weight. Fire-rated openings require ball bearing hinges per NFPA 80; confirm the raised barrel model carries the appropriate listing for the door label.
  • Number of hinges — the same quantity rules apply as with standard full mortise hinges: three hinges for doors up to 90 inches tall, one additional hinge per additional 30 inches.
  • Handing on beveled-edge models — confirm hand whenever bevel is involved; ordering the wrong hand on a beveled raised barrel hinge is a non-trivial mistake on a specialty item.

Applications Across Building Types

Raised barrel hinges appear across a wide range of commercial construction scenarios:

  • Healthcare corridors with heavy hollow metal frames and deep masonry reveals, where full door swing clearance is required for bed and cart passage
  • School and institutional buildings undergoing renovation, where new doors are being hung in existing frames built to older dimensional standards
  • Industrial and warehouse facilities where slip bucks or heavy-gauge frames create non-standard door face positions
  • Double egress cross-corridor assemblies in any occupancy, where the alternate head profile makes standard barrel hinges physically incompatible

Preferred Hinge Lines to Consider

When sourcing raised barrel hinges, brands with stable product lines and consistent dimensional tolerances reduce the risk of compatibility surprises — especially important on specialty items where a substitution mid-project creates real problems. McKinney offers a documented raised barrel family (RB-series) in standard and heavy weight, for both square and beveled edge conditions. Hager and Markar (with the RB suffix option on continuous hinges) also catalog raised barrel configurations. The Bottom Line for Installers and Specifiers

A raised barrel hinge is not a universal upgrade — it is the correct solution for a specific geometry problem. Spec it when the frame reveal or head profile is the constraint, confirm edge type and door weight before ordering, and check opening degree against the manufacturer’s published limit for that barrel height. Getting those three things right prevents a callbacks and keeps the schedule moving.
